Serbia - Environmentally Related Tax Revenue from Taxes on Energy in Air Transport
Since 2014, Serbia Environmentally Related Tax Revenue from Taxes on Energy in Air Transport rose 11% year on year. At $31.63 Million in 2019, the country was number 12 among other countries in Environmentally Related Tax Revenue from Taxes on Energy in Air Transport. Serbia is overtaken by Romania, which was ranked number 11 with $37.15 Million and is followed by Spain at $31.29 Million. Canada topped the ranking with $4,367.2 Million in 2019, that is a decrease of 0.5% versus 2018. United Kingdom, Turkey and Greece resp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Slovenia witnessed the best average annual growth at +19.2% per year, while Hungary was the worst growing country at -67% per year.
